Grand jury indicts rapper Mystikal, 2 others in Caddo rape, kidnapping case

A Caddo grand jury has indicted a New Orleans-based rapper in connection with an assault. The indictment Tuesday charges 46-year-old Michael Lawrence Tyler, who goes by the name Mystikal, with one count each of first-degree rape and second-degree kidnapping.

 His bond has been set at $3 million. Last month, he surrendered to authorities at Caddo Correctional Center. The Prairieville resident said he turned himself in "to get this business reconciled, get this behind me, man."

Mystikal is known for his work with rapper Master P (Percy Miller) and his Top 20 hits "Shake Ya Ass/Shake It Fast" and "Danger (Been So Long)," both of which were released in 2000.
